About ClimateCrete
ClimateCrete provides technology to convert locally excavated materials and desert sand into concrete-ready aggregates. This process reduces the construction industry's reliance on environmentally damaging, imported river sand. The resulting concrete formulation offers a competitively priced product with a significantly lower carbon footprint.

Where is ClimateCrete located?
ClimateCrete is based in San Jose, United States.
When was ClimateCrete founded?
ClimateCrete was founded in 2023.
How much funding has ClimateCrete raised?
ClimateCrete has raised $3.3M.
Who founded ClimateCrete?
ClimateCrete was founded by Anastasiya Bavykina, Jorge Gascon and Juan Manuel Colom Díaz.
